Key learning outcomes | The aim of the bachelor study programme is to equip the graduate with a set of basic theoretical knowledge in the field of Czech and world history and auxiliary historical sciences. At the same time, the student will be able to apply these theoretical knowledge in the field of education and training. In accordance with the requirements of the practice, the basic aim of the study field is to prepare students for their future educational activities or other professional activities, which implies the need to master the given social science disciplines, the basics of pedagogy, psychology, informatics and other subjects of a general basis. | ||||

Occupational profiles of graduates with examples | The graduate has profound knovledge of history from antiquity to 20th century (included) with special emphasis on the history of the Czech lands in the European and world kontext. He has good communicative competencies, is capable of understanding the relations between historcal events, and systematic presentation and explanation. After graduation the student is qualified for continuation in the master level of the study programme and for various other forms of further studies. | ||||
